Intended use Fraction collector F9-R is an automated fraction collector intended for the collection of fractions from purification runs. It is intended for research use only, and shall not be used in clinical procedures, or for diagnostic purposes.

Introduction The ÄKTA instrument supplies the Fraction collector F9-R with power. This section describes how to perform an emergency shutdown of the Fraction collector F9-R by shutting down the ÄKTA instrument. This section also describes the result in the event of power failure or network interrup- tion.
Page 17
The sample and data may be lost as a result of switching off the power. Power failure In case of a power failure or if communication is lost, the run is interrupted immediately and all moving parts in the fraction collector are stopped. Fraction collector F9-R Operating Instructions 29656880 AA...

4.1.2 Space requirements 4.1.2 Space requirements Introduction This section describes the different options of placement of Fraction collector F9-R and the space required. Location Place the fraction collector on a clean, flat and stable area that is able to support the weight of the fraction collector.
Page 29
Size and weight The size and weight of the fraction collector are stated in the table below. Parameter Value W (width) 320 mm H (height) 250 mm D (depth) 400 mm Weight 5 kg Fraction collector F9-R Operating Instructions 29656880 AA...

The Node ID for Fraction collector F9-R is set by positioning the arrow of the rotating switch at the back of the fraction collector. Use a screwdriver to set the arrow of the switch to the desired number.
